Forecasts

For Three (11/8), Beyondtemptation (3/1), Fanzio (4/1), Placedela Concorde (5/1), Ormesher (16/1), Horst (20/1)

Verdict

Not the easiest of races to fathom the probable chain of events. However with the much respected Fanzio in the line-up, and the regular pace-setter Ormesher also present and correct, Miss Hexham herself Beyondtemptation almost certainly won't have things all her own way up front as was the case when she romped to victory over 2m4f here ten days ago. Therefore, we'll chance that the shrewd Brian Hughes can tuck in behind the pace aboard the recent smooth course winner (novices') FOR THREE and pounce late on as others begin to slowly wilt and flounder for their earlier exertions.
  1. For Three
  2. Fanzio
  3. Beyondtemptation
